El mar, 22-10-2024 a las 13:57 -0300, Giancarlo Razzolini escribió: > If individual attribution is needed, it can be obtained using version > control history. Yes, but this does not happen when moving a package from AUR to the official repositories. For example in the case of the package we are talking about there is no git history [1] since it stayed in the AUR [2]. However that could be a very good solution, always move the git repository from the AUR when a package is promoted and vice versa (move the git from the official repository to the AUR) when the package is left without maintainer.
